Cake Preparation
- Preheat oven to 350°F and grease and flour three 9-inch cake pans.
- Cream together 1 cup softened butter and 2 cups gran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
-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
- In a separate bowl, mix flour, baking soda, and baking powder.
- Combine buttermilk with 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
- Alternate adding dry ingredients and buttermilk mixture to the butter mixture, mixing until just combined.
- Fold in shredded coconut and chopped pecans.
- Divide batter evenly among pans and bake for 25–30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let cakes cool completely on wire racks.
Frosting Preparation
- For the frosting, beat cream cheese and 1/2 cup butter until smooth.
- Gradually add powdered sugar and 1/2 teaspoon vanilla, beating until fluffy.
- Assemble cake by layering with frosting between each layer and on top. Garnish with extra pecans and toasted coconut if desired.
